Subject: Backfill scheduler cut-over complete

Team,

The nightly backfill scheduler moved from the legacy Croftwell box to the new Ternhollow cluster last night. Jobs ran clean on the first pass; no missed windows. Old host is drained and will be decommissioned Friday.

Security-relevant changes: service account rotated, job definitions now pulled from the signed manifest store, and outbound access restricted to the warehouse subnet. Audit logging is on by default.

For your review, the scheduler's active configuration is reproduced below.

deployment values, yadug-bawif:
[framir]
team = pelox
access_code = ac_a38ab2
owner = tamion.julael
host = framir.tolvaqlabs.test
port = 11211
peer = tammir.zemvargrid.local
salt = 2215ef03
pin = 1541

**Q: How does Lanternkit version its shared components?**

Good question! Lanternkit follows semver, but with a twist: minor bumps can deprecate plugin hooks, so pin your range carefully. We publish a compatibility matrix with every release, and plugin authors get a two-version grace window before deprecated hooks vanish. If your plugin breaks on a patch release, that's on us — file it. One more thing: restoring your signing profile after a registry reset requires the recovery passphrase, which is as follows:

unlock words, bagag-kajef: zormir-jorath-tammir-oliius-briix-norys

## Order Cutoff Limits

Marrow & Rye Bakery enforces a daily cutoff for next-day custom orders. Orders placed after the cutoff roll to the following production day automatically; there are no manual overrides. Quotas cap per-customer order counts to protect oven capacity during the Lindenport holiday rush. The current cutoff and quota constants are defined below.

constants for hahip-hafog:
WEIGHTS = {
    "feniel": 55,
    "kasox": 667,
}

Subject: Cut-over complete — Veldrome hot-reload

Hi all — welcome to the team, and a quick summary. As of Monday, Veldrome no longer requires restarts for config changes; the watcher process detects edits and reloads within a few seconds. The cut-over went cleanly, with one brief hiccup when a malformed file was rejected as designed. If you change config, just save and verify the reload log entry. For reference, the service currently runs with these values.

service settings:
[casax]
port = 6379
team = rusir
host = casax.zemvarhq.corp
region = outer-4
access_code = ac_9808ce
timeout_ms = 1500